Imminent Bounce

Friday's late day save is hinting towards a short term bounce. It may be powerful enough to keep the uptrend going, but it is unknown for how long. The last few weeks did their part to shake short term traders and investors out of their positions and now, dip buyers have stepped in to pick up the mess that was left in the wake of the destruction. Unfortunately there are very few stocks left that are worth buying, but that may change depending on this weeks action. For now, I believe APPA was a good buy. CNLG looked like a good buy but it turned out to be a dud that cost me a lousy 19% loss. I held on for too long hoping for a bounce which never came. Another stock that I remain positive on is SPU, even though it is down from my initial buy. Even HPJ and ONP may give us decent bounces. Still, I will be on the lookout for fresh breakouts with promising catalysts. These new stocks which may breakout will be the next leaders in the upcoming uptrend. These will be the stocks that will have a high probability of giving us handsome returns.
